Biography

My research focuses on digital electronics, advanced signal processing, and Machine Learning applied to nuclear and high-energy physics.

During my PhD at the University of Valencia (2017-2019, 2022-2024), I concentrated on optimizing the firmware for the NEDA detector [1]. This work involved implementing advanced trigger algorithms for neutron-gamma discrimination (Charge Comparison and Time-of-Flight), developing lossless online data compression systems on Virtex-6 FPGAs, and performing pile-up reconstruction using 1D convolutional autoencoders. These contributions were experimentally validated through beam tests and analyzed using high-precision Python workflows.

Since 2023, I have been conducting research at IFIC and the University of Valencia, applying artificial intelligence techniques to enhance Data Acquisition (DAQ) systems for NEDA, GRIT [2], and AGATA [3]. My background also includes a tenure at CMS-CERN (2019-2021), where I evaluated radiation effects on microchips (TID tests) via automated analysis pipelines. I have disseminated these advancements through peer-reviewed publications and international conferences, actively driving innovation in scientific instrumentation.
